Bottle split at CBC Clerko, thanks to Bradley D Finkelstien IV, 06/01/15. Hazed orange amber with a decent off white covering. Nose is plum forward, tangy green berry, musty wood, light acidic vibe, tarte goosberry. Taste comprises fleshy plum decay, funk, must, straw, citric rind, tangy red berry. Medium bodied, fine carbonation, semi drying close with gentle puckering. Solid sour, loads of depth and flavour for the ABV.

Poured from a bottle. Aroma is fairly fruit forward with a nice plum character. Light acidity and hints of citrus. Hints of tropical fruit as well. Pours a cloudy, pale brown with a small, thick white head that exhibits good retention and lacing. Flavor is fruity, but less noticeably plum. Moderate acidity with hints of citrus and tropical fruit. Mouthfeel is medium bodied with medium high carbonation. Low astringency and low alcohol warmth. Overall, an enjoyable plum sour. The plum comes through better than in other plum sours.

Bottle thanks to Zack Sanchez. It pours murky amber-blush with a small white head. The is fresh, fruity, plum skin, hay, earth, must, funk, oak and vanilla. The taste is crisp, bitter, plum, sherbet, grape skin, decent mouth-pucker, oak, vanilla and sharp lemon-lime with a crisp, tart finish. Medium body and fine, prickly carbonation. Crisp, tart & juicy. Rather tasty.
